EmpCo against Greenwashing
After the 27th of September 2026 private certification systems must comply with the key requirements of the EU Empowering Consumers Directive against greenwashing, otherwise they will not be accepted any more as source for the B to C marketing of green claims.
To be valid under the EU directive, certification systems must meet five key requirements:
1. Public, clearly defined standards
2. Independent third-party verification
3. Ongoing monitoring and enforcement
4. Transparent governance structures
5. Accurate and verifiable claims
Where do the seals stand today?
How far do the international and national certificates systems for sustainable tourism already operate or aim to operate according to the EmpCo? ECOTRANS has asked 24 leading national and international certificates. The results were presented on the 26th March to more than 250 participants at the German Webinar Series on “EmpCo”, organised by the German Tourism Association. 21 of the 24 certificates declared that they already operate or aim to operate until September according to the EmpCo.

"Pro EmpCo" certified tourism: source for monitoring and marketing
For destinations, marketing and promotion organisations the list of “Pro EmpCo” certificates and the listings of their certified businesses are very helpful: for monitoring their resilience and green transition as well as for supporting the market access of credibly certified hotels, camping sites, and other certified tourism enterprises. The “Pro EmpCo” systems - together with public certifications like the EU Ecolabel - currently have certified and publish on the Travel Green Planet Maps about 13,000 accommodation businesses in Europe, including 1,600 in Germany.
